Buckeyes
- 1 lb. peanut butter
- 1/2 lb. (1 c.) margarine, room temperature or melted and cooled
- 1 1/2 lb. confectioners sugar (about)
- 1 (12 oz.) pkg. semi-sweet real chocolate chips (not chocolate flavored chips)
- 1 (2 x 1 1/2-inch) piece paraffin (from Gulf's 2 1/2 x 5-inch 4 oz. bar)
